Summary
Most of us, when formulating an opinion or perspective about a cultural issue tend to look at one side of the story – myself included. But if we have any chance of making societal and cultural changes that actually improve our way of life, it's crucial that we look at what we see from all sides.
That's what my guest today, Brandon Tatum, and I talk about – seeing problems from all angles and waiting for all the information before formulating opinions. We cover the Kyle Rittenhouse and Ahmaud Arbery cases, the dangers of the "Defund the Police" movement and what, if any reform in policing is needed, whether or not systemic racism actually exists, our emotions and our responses to them, use of force laws, and so much more.
